Yetunde Abiola, BA (Hons) French, MA French Literature

Yetunde Abiola has been researching her family history for 13 years. She travels extensively for family history research and is conversant with the interplay of histories and politics in today’s multi-cultural world. Her areas of expertise include the impact of ancestor stories on the lives of future generations and, the complexities and intricacies of Caribbean, Diasporan, and colonial genealogies.
